

INKA Paletten GmbH is one of the largest European manufacturer of disposable pallets made in a similar way like particle board (processed wood according to ISPM15).
The first INKA presswood pallet was made in 1971 in Siegertsbrunn just outside Munich. The registered office of the company is still located there today. In the meantime, INKA Paletten Germany is a member of the globally operating INKA Group. In Benelux-countries INKA pallets are distributed by Presswood Holland and in the UK by INKA Presswood Pallets Ltd.
INKA presswood pallets are available in all standard sizes, ranging from a ¼ pallet to the CP3 format.
Distribution is carried out via an area-wide distribution network in Europe and numerous other countries worldwide.
INKA pallets are manufactured according to a guaranteed pest-free process. Therefore, INKAs are preeminently suitable for worldwide exportation as a universal cargo carrier. Potential quarantine regulations of various countries (such as ISPM15 / NIMF 15) need not be taken into consideration when using INKA pallets.

What does the PEFC Chain of Custody certificate mean?
PEFC, the Programme for the Endorsement of Forest Certification, is the world’s leading forest certification system. The PEFC Chain of Custody certificate proves the origin of INKA presswood pallets. It demonstrates that INKA pallets are made only from sustainably managed forests.
Using a PEFC label informs our customers about environmentally and socially responsible aspects of our INKA pallets.

EUDR deforestation regulation: Inka pallets are exempt as recycled products
August 2025
The EU Deforestation Regulation (EUDR), which came into force in 2023 and will apply from December 2025, aims to put a stop to global deforestation. Among other things, users of wooden pallets and packaging will then have to prove that their suppliers' products comply with the EUDR.
We are also receiving enquiries about the EUDR conformity of our pallets. We can give our customers the all-clear: The EUDR requirements do not apply to Inka pallets. Our pressed wood pallets are made from 100 per cent recycled wood. Products like ours, which are made entirely from material that has reached the end of its life cycle and would otherwise be disposed of as waste, are exempt from the due diligence requirements of the EUDR. With the Inka pallet, you are therefore shipping a forest-friendly product - and are also on the safe side in terms of EUDR.
